Advantages of VoIP Systems

One of the main advantages of VoIP phone systems is the considerable cost savings they bring to businesses of all sizes. Traditional phone systems typically come with elevated monthly fees, long-distance charges, and maintenance costs. In  voip phones and service , voice over IP technology permits businesses to make calls over the web, dispensing with the need for extensive phone lines and lowering overall telecommunication expenses. This transition not just lowers operational costs but also allows companies to redirect their funds toward other critical areas of growth.

Additionally, VoIP telephone systems offer scalability that further enhances cost efficiency. As a business grows, adding new lines or extensions to a traditional phone system can be a burdensome and pricey process. VoIP systems can efficiently accommodate additional users without the need for substantial hardware investments. This flexibility enables companies to adapt to shifting needs and minimize costs associated with scaling their communication infrastructure.

Moreover, many VoIP phone systems offer a variety of features that would usually incur extra fees in traditional setups, such as voicemail, call forwarding, and conferencing capabilities. By consolidating these features into a unified service, businesses can enhance their communication processes while also benefiting from reduced overall expenses. This comprehensive approach to telecommunications not only saves money but also boosts productivity and encourages better collaboration among team members.

Enhanced Functions of VoIP Systems

VoIP communication systems offer a multitude of innovative capabilities that greatly boost communication for both companies and customers. One of the most notable characteristics is the ability to integrate with various applications and software. This enables that users can smoothly link their VoIP technologies with CRM tools, messaging systems, and various productivity software, resulting in for seamless operations and better resource management. Such integration can promote more productive communication and boost overall performance.

Another major advantage of VoIP carriers is the offering of HD voice quality. Unlike legacy landlines, VoIP systems transmits voice signals and leverages the web to deliver calls, which frequently leads to clearer audio and minimal background noise. This improvement in voice clarity makes conversations more enjoyable and satisfactory, lessening errors that can arise from subpar audio quality. As a result, users experience more successful conversations whether they are in the workplace or telecommuting.

Furthermore, VoIP technologies come with a variety of functionalities that can be adapted to meet unique user needs. These may encompass forwarding calls, voicemail transcription, virtual meeting capabilities and audio logging. These advanced features not only enhance user experience but also provide businesses with the resources necessary to optimize operations and boost customer service.
